Guest Review of the Dalton Hotel & Suites
June 14, 2011
My siblings and I got together and planned a surprise trip for my parents to
Victoria as a Christmas gift. They arrived in Victoria on June 4th, and were
shocked at the hotel we had chosen. From the information we had given them,
based on reviews and the hotels website, they were going to be looking forward
to a charming, renovated, romantic hotel room, which we had spent almost $200
per night on. This was not the case. First of all, the location of the hotel is
very sketchy - when my parents cab pulled up there was a passed out, half
dressed, teenage girl lying on the sidewalk in front of the hotel. Apparently
this was something they saw a lot of out of their window. There were also
consistently police there picking up homeless people and breaking up fights.
Once they finally made it to their room, they were disgusted! First of all, no
lights worked in the room. There were holes punched in the walls, the floor
tiles were cracked and a lot were missing. There was a very old couch that was
discolored and stained. They could not use the sink in the bathroom because when
they ran the water it flowed through all the cracks and flooded the floor. The
bed was full of hairs and food crumbs, and that's just the start of the
complaints! They called me to find out where we had heard of the hotel and I was
just as shocked. When I called the front desk and explained that we had paid for
a room with a fireplace and a balcony or veranda, french doors, beautiful new
fixtures, etc...the person at the desk told me that none of the rooms had any of
those amenities. He did move them to a king suite, as i told him there was no
way they would be staying in the provided room even for one night. When I asked
what would happen if they chose not to stay there at all, I was told that
because it was pre-paid it was non refundable and there was nothing they could
do.
They were moved into the king suite, and upon first inspection it was at the
very least a bit more modern. It had a king bed and a kitchen nook, but again no
balcony or veranda. I believe there might have been a fire place. The bed was so
slanted at the head board that they had to sleep sideways on the bed. They could
not use the bathtub/shower because the taps, plugs and tub itself were covered
in a slimy substance that made them both physically ill. They could not get into
the kitchen nook or even open the mini fridge because there was a pole wedged in
to the floor in the nook that was literally holding up the floor of the room
above them.
When the finally went out to supper, there was a sign up on the door stating
that if guests weren't back and in the hotel by 1:00 a.m. they would not be let
in, as the doors were locked at that time and there would be absolutely no
admittance at all. sure makes you feel safe and secure hey.
they were able to speak to the front desk manager that again was no help at all.
His story was different than the person at the front desk in that he said that
they do have a few rooms with balconies and fire places but that there was
nothing he could do for them.
my parents were so upset and uncomfortable with their experience that they spent
an extra $800 to come home after only one night on their vacation, as that was
more cost effective for them than having to pay for another hotel and then all
the other costs of a trip. i am disgusted and very angry. I have emailed the
front desk manager so that everything is documented and have yet to have any
response.
To add to the upset, my parents had been on a cruise the week before this part
of their trip and when they talked to people from Victoria and told them where
they were staying people were shocked and their responses weren't great. You
know it's bad when the people from the city that the hotel is in have disgusted
looks on their faces. i would never ever every recommend this place to anyone,
and i am almost thinking that all these "great" reviews were either written by
staff and management or were for a different place!
Dalton Hotel, General Manager at Dalton Hotel & Suites, responded to this
review
June 23, 2011
I want to first of all thank you for bringing your complaint to my front desk
supervisor’s attention.
Your email crossed my desk late last week and an investigation was immediately
conducted.
After reviewing and dissecting your email to its length, I met with the head
housekeeper to review the guest rooms in question, and with front desk staff
that had direct contact with your parents during their stay.
After concluding my investigation, I will commence by addressing your email
first. There was criticism regarding the Hotel’s exterior appearance. The Dalton
Hotel which was built in 1876 is a heritage acclaimed Hotel and thus its
exterior is protected by the Heritage Society of Victoria. No work can be done
to beautify the exterior without the consent of the Heritage Society.
Drawing your attention to the guest room remarks, specifically that there was
only one working light, the missing floor tiles, holes in walls, etc., these are
false accusations that are being put forth. All of the boutique guest rooms are
flawless because they are being well maintained on a daily basis. We took
special consideration when these rooms were renovated, providing the guest with
new carpets, high end wallpaper, granite countertops, 3 way shower nozzles,
California blinds and obviously deluxe mattress and beddings, to name a few.
I saw no evidence of the remarks that was put forth in your email.
Your remark on our boutique rooms of not having verandas or fireplaces does not
have merit either. All of our boutique SUITES come with fireplaces and only one
(1) is available with a Romeo & Juliet style veranda, as mentioned and labeled
on the website.
When the room was booked online, it was apparent that a non-suite boutique room
was chosen which obviously does not come with a fireplace.
Your additional remark that the bed being slanted or slimy substances in the
bath tub does not have value either. As mentioned above, all our beds are new
and are considered one of the best in the industry. As for slimy substances in
the bath tub, all our rooms are inspected by our head housekeeper BEFORE being
released into inventory for booking reservations. If the room is not inspected,
it does not put back into inventory. This rule is strictly enforced.
I was perplexed by a statement made by my guest services agent when interviewed
who was present when your parents were checking out. It was mentioned by your
father that the “…room was fine…. but ... there was problems at home….as the
main reason for leaving early.” I hope that you concur that this is an odd
statement given all the alleged remarks you made.
Lastly your remark about the testimonials are written by my staff members is
absurd. Our website provider can confirm the origin of the guest comments
crossed referenced to their respective stay.
Being that we are in the hospitality industry, my staff and I strive to make
sure that all of our guests have a positive experience during their stay at the
Dalton Hotel. It should be note that since the reservation in question was made
via the Advance Purchase Program, no refunds can be provided in lieu of the
discounted rate. This was acknowledged on your end when the reservation was
booked.
However, according to your email, your parents allegedly did not have a positive
experience during their stay. Despite the false allegations, I will offer a two
(2) night VIP future stay as my guests in a boutique suite. I will require the
most current mailing address so that I can expedite the gift certificate.
I trust that I have answered all your questions and concerns and I look forward
to you reply.
Regards, John Lioudakis | General Manager |
